Plugin authors: the rebalancing heuristic in SpokeShift now weighs dock starvation over truck mileage. If your plugin overrides `score_station`, don't re-implement decay — the core applies it after your hook returns. Also, clamp your outputs to [0, 1]; anything above gets silently truncated and you'll waste an afternoon debugging it like the Larkfield pilot team did. Keep side effects out of scoring; cache lookups belong in `prepare()`. The defaults below were tuned against the Brindleton fleet and are safe starting points.

constants for tageg-kagag:
QUOTAS = {
    "kelax": 495,
    "istath": 366,
    "tammir": 108,
    "novdor": 730,
    "casax": 816,
    "quenael": 874,
    "pelius": 403,
}

Handover Note — Divestiture of the Fenwright Components Unit

Mira — taking over where I left off. Diligence with the buyer, Castellan Group, is about 70% done; their questions have centered on the Dunmere facility lease and pension carve-out. Legal is solid, but keep an eye on the working-capital peg — they'll push on it. Board wants a signing recommendation next month. I've flagged the two open risks in the data room. The pricing strategy is captured in the note below.

internal memo for faweg-tafog: Only 7 of the 100 pilot accounts renewed Quenael, so a churn review is set for April 15.

Handover note — Crumbwheel order cutoffs.

Welcome aboard. The bakery cutoff rule in Crumbwheel closes same-day orders at 14:00 local to each storefront, not UTC — this has bitten us twice. Holiday overrides live in the calendar service and take precedence silently, so always check there first when a cutoff looks wrong. To unlock the calendar service's admin console after a restart, enter the recovery passphrase below.

vault phrase of bagap-bahaf = silion-pelox-sorox-casdor-quenwyn-fraax-eliox-praael-kelion-quenvan-kasox-rusael-norius-belvan